James Herman “Jim” Rohloff, Sr., 81, of Salina, Kansas, passed away on Sunday, August 31, 2025.

Jim was born in Woodbine, Kansas, on November 11, 1943, to Nancy Valentine (Hird) and Wilbert Henry Rohloff. After high school, he served his country as an infantryman in the United States Army. Following his military service, Jim spent most of his working life as a dedicated truck driver, traveling the roads with pride and purpose.

In his free time, Jim enjoyed fishing and visiting the casino. He was known for always giving a helping hand.

Jim is survived by his life partner, Marie Collins; two sons, Joey "Joe" Rohloff (Susie) and Jeffrey Rohloff; and two brothers, Jerry Rohloff (Dixie) and Gary Rohloff. He also leaves behind many beloved grandchildren and great-grandchildren who will carry his memory forward with love.

He was preceded in death by his parents; his son, Jimmy Jr.; and his sister, Carol Clements.

A memorial gathering will be held from 1:00 PM to 3:00 PM on Monday, September 29, 2025 at Carlson-Geisendorf Funeral Home in Salina, Kansas.
